Publisher Description: Follow two children as they celebrate their ancestors in this bilingual introduction to el D a de los Muertos-- the Day of the Dead They prepare offerings of flowers, sugar skulls, and special bread, and make delicious foods to eat and share. By spreading marigold petals, they guide the dead home to join the festivities. After hours of singing, dancing, and reminiscing, it's time for bed. The festivities are described in brief, lyrical text, presented in both Spanish and English. An author's note provides more detail on the holiday, its historical context, and the inspiration behind the artwork. Bob Barner's signature collages incorporate the traditional Day of the Dead symbols and bright, bold colors to evoke the joyful atmosphere of this vibrant holiday. Contributor Bio(s): Barner, Bob: - Bob Barner has written and illustrated more than twenty-five books and has won the Parents' Choice Award and the Teachers' Choice Award. According to the Booklist review of Bug Safari, "Barner's cheerful illustrations offer a dizzying array of perspectives...Bright, cut-paper collages will appeal to the youngest (readers)." He lives in San Francisco, California. |
